Placing A Buy Or Sell Order On Questrade

Available Questrade order types. # market, limit, stop, stop limit, Good until end of day / canceled.

Questrade Market Order

A Questrade market order is an order to buy or sell a stock at the market's current best available price. A market order usually ensures an execution, but it does not guarantee a specified price. Market orders are optimal when the primary goal is to execute the trade immediately. Questrade market orders are executed by a broker or brokerage service on behalf of clients who wish to take advantage of the best price available on the current market. Questrade market orders are popular as they are a fast and reliable method of either entering or exiting a trade.

Questrade Limit Order

A Questrade limit order is an order to buy or sell a stock with a restriction on the maximum price to be paid or the minimum price to be received. If the order is subsequently filled, it will only be at the specified limit price or better. However, having said this, there is no assurance of execution.

Questrade Stop Order

A Questrade stop order, also referred to as a stop-loss order, is an order to buy or sell a stock once the price of the stock reaches a specified price, known as the stop price. When the stop price is reached, a stop order becomes a market order. A sell stop order is entered at a stop price below the current market price. If the stock reaches the stop price, the order becomes a market order and is filled at the next available market price.

Questrade Stop Limit Order

A Questrade stop-limit order is an order to buy or sell a stock that combines the features of a stop order and a limit order. Once the stop price is reached, a stop-limit order becomes a limit order that will be executed at a specified price (or better). The Questrade stop-limit order triggers a limit order when a stock price hits the stop level. A Questrade stop-limit order can be helpful when trading if you are unable to watch your trades all day.
